problem with HP proliant ML330 and feodra core 2

hello everybody,

i've bought a HP proliant ml330 but when i try to instal fedora core 2, it's seems that the raid it's not compatible with the OS. the harddisk it's not recognise.

i have another problem with freebsd, that i cannot instal on the same server, because it's seems that another time there is a problem with the disk.

is there any patch or upgrading that can help me??

Re: problem with HP proliant ML330 and feodra core 2

Fedora Core may not be able to use hardware raid, but if the disk is recognized, you can use software raid in the disk druid option at installation.

All HP proliant servers have a cd that you can get or download. Its a boot cd that you have to use to set up the disk/raid prior to Linux installation.

Thats available in the server section of itrc and the support site. Start with http://itrc.hp.com and find the utility for your specific model.

Re: problem with HP proliant ML330 and feodra core 2

What RAID controller? A ML330 has none. It only has dual-onboard SCSI by default.

Unless you added one yourself? If so, what type?
